Has anyone come across this one before?

Today when I opened the boot, I could hear what sounded like water inside the boot lid, sloshing and falling through to the bottom of it as the lid was raised. It sounded just like water, but on checking all the welds, it looks OK, ie no signs of any places where any fluids could have got in. Any ideas? Planning on going to the stealers tomorrow morning.

Get them to check the seals on the back of the lights in the boot lid.... water can be forced down through this when driven in hard rain, and to compound this, the drain holes in the corners of the boot lid get blocked with...... antirust wax.... :audibash:
